WebSymptoms of alcohol withdrawal usually begin within six to 24 hours of the last drink and peak at between 36 and 72 hours. Fever, excessive sweating, and dehydration. Dilated pupils and loss of appetite. Nausea, diarrhea, and vomiting. Fatigue and depression. Tremors, especially in the hands. Web18 aug. 2024 · There are a few different treatment options for alcohol withdrawal, depending on the severity of the symptoms. In some cases, a person may be able to detox at home with the help of family and friends.
